Tomorrow the sun shines in many places and it will remain largely dry. The temperature rises to around 24 degrees.
The weather will change from Thursday. This is partly due to the aftermath of Hurricane and the remains of tropical storm Fernand. Together those systems provide a lot of rain in our country.
Grand Prix
Those who go to the Grand Prix this weekend would do well to bring an umbrella or raincoat. “On Saturday and Sunday, the rain chances will decrease rather than,” says Weerman Jan Visser on NH Radio. “The chance of rain is 80 to 90 percent.” Especially in the coastal areas, a lot of precipitation can fall, locally 50 to 80 millimeters.
The temperatures remain on the mild side: during the day it will be around 20 degrees. Even in the following week, the mercury does not drop much further, but it will remain changeable for the time being.
